Meta whistleblower details connection to China, fueling US Senate anger

By Madeline Hughes ( April 9, 2025, 23:35 GMT | Insight) -- A former Facebook global executive testified today before the US Senate about Chief Executive Mark Zuckerberg's connection to the Chinese government, including handing over Americans’ data and creating AI censorship tools, putting Zuckerberg further under fire. Senator Josh Hawley, who chairs the subcommittee on counterterrorism that held today’s hearing, said he hopes today’s testimony will “strengthen the spine of my colleagues” because “it's time for Congress to act.
